#d8d1e8 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d8d1e8 is composed of 84.7% red, 82% green and 91%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 6.9% cyan, 9.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 9% black. It has a hue angle of 258.3 degrees, a saturation of 33.3% and a lightness of 86.5%. #d8d1e8 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#b1a3d1. Closest websafe color is: #ccccff.

● #d8d1e8 color description : Light grayish violet.
#d8d1e8 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d8d1e8 has RGB values of R:216, G:209, B:232 and CMYK values of C:0.07, M:0.1, Y:0, K:0.09. Its decimal value is 14209512.

Shades and Tints of #d8d1e8
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040306 is the darkest color, while #f9f8fc is the lightest one.

Tones of #d8d1e8
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#dcdcdd is the less saturated color, while #d0bcfd is the most saturated one.
